What the numbers mean in Silverhill town
Housing cost measured against local earnings.
A household earning the Silverhill town median would spend about 23.7% of gross income on the median rent. The 30% mark is the federal threshold for cost burden, so anything above it signals a stretched rental market. The median home costs 4.3× the median household income; nationally that ratio sits near 4.5×. Poverty affects 6.6% of residents and 79.9% of households own their home.
Source: US Census Bureau, ACS 2019-2023 5-year estimates · rates as published for 2019-2023 ACS 5-year
